    Default Russian M44 - HOLY SHEEPDIP Batman!

    Well the only one good thing that happened at the range (see my Sunset hill thread in the ranges section for that mess) today was a very nice gentleman that was firing a cannon a few lanes down from my family. Every time this thing went off I my son and I would say WTF is that thing so I finally walked down and asked him what the howitzer he was firing was.

    He showed me a Russian M44, I had never see one before and the gentleman was nice enough to ask me if I wanted to fire it, well always being one to try something new I said SURE. He let me put three rounds through it and I have to say that is one MONSTER of a weapon. He also allowed my son to put a round through it (after some kidding about being a wuss) too. He gave a quick explanation about the rifle, the cost of one and where to find ammo ... just a truly nice guy.

    So anyway I came home and zipped up to gunbrokers.com and sure enough the damn things are dirt cheap. Also read the history of them and found the production numbers and I am thinking of picking one up just for sh*ts and giggles.

    Anything I should specifically look for? Are they accurate (once you get over the shell shock of firing one of course) .... I also saw the BIG production numbers were 1944 and 1945, are their any premiums for 43, 46, 47 and 48.

    Once again new territory for this old boy so I'll "ask the experts"

    Default Re: Russian M44 - HOLY SHEEPDIP Batman!

    the 44's are or can be kinda funny, they tend to shot best with the bayo extended.
    i also 'am more a fan of the rifle, so i have a 91/30...i think it was like 90 bucks otd.
    i've been thinking about stepping up to a '38, basicly the same gun as teh 44, but without the bayo.
    i would not delay in picking one up. the 7.62x54r has steadly been creeping up in price.....it's still pretty cheap, but not what it was even just 2 years ago.
    pick one of the shorties up and go shooting at dusk, and the fire balls will be fly'n.


    fix a bayo on the 91/30, and teh bullets are not needed. it'll have 75 yrd bayonetting range.

    Default Re: Russian M44 - HOLY SHEEPDIP Batman!

    If you aren't a history buff, you might save a few bucks or get a nicer example if you don't mind a post-war dated example.

    There's too much discussion about M44s for a single post here, so feel free to browse this link:
    http://www.google.com/search?hl=en&a...i=&safe=images


    Personally I prefer the M38 carbine. It's almost the same as the M44, but lacks the bayonet. As such, it has much better balance.

    Just a word of warning: they are habit forming.
